Gameplay and Features
French roulette is similar to European roulette, but with a few key differences. The game is played on a single-zero wheel, which reduces the house edge and improves the player’s odds of winning. Additionally, French roulette uses the “La Partage” rule, which gives players half of their bet back if the ball lands on zero. This rule further lowers the house edge, making French roulette a popular choice for players looking to maximize their chances of winning.

House Edge and Payouts
The house edge in French roulette is only 1.35%, thanks to the single-zero wheel and the “La Partage” rule. This low house edge gives players a better chance of winning and makes French roulette a popular choice among experienced gamblers. In terms of payouts, French roulette follows the standard payout structure of 35:1 for a straight bet and 1:1 for an even-money bet.
